Qiangtegu Nail Glue
Qiangtegu Nail Glue was recalled on 24 July 2015 under EU Safety Gate alert A12/0932/15. Chemical risk reported by Denmark. The glue contains an excessive amount of chloroform (measured value 5.

Risk Description
The glue contains an excessive amount of chloroform (measured value 5.7 % by weight). Exposure to chloroform fumes can cause damage to internal organs, mainly the liver and kidney, as well as risk of cancer.The product does not comply with the REACH Regulation.

Product Description
Small plastic bottle of nail glue, supplied in plastic packaging on pink cardboard.
